Enjoy the beginning of Episode IV: A New Hope in Minecraft style.
The short clip was made by my favorite Star Wars-loving Minecraft fan, a guy named Grahame — Paradise Decay on YouTube — who also rendered Empire Strikes Back’s Battle of Hoth and the Asteroid Chase and A New Hope’s Trench Flight in Minecraft .
